    Seismic fragility assessment of reinforced concrete moment frames retrofitted with strongback braced system

    No full text
    This study focused on analysing the seismic fragility and retrofitting of reinforced concrete flexural frames using strongback braced system. Using the steel strongback braced system as a means of seismically strengthening and retrofitting reinforced concrete moment frames (RCMFs), this research aims to enhance the effectiveness of RCMFs. In this study, RCMFs of 5-, 10-, and 15-stories are designed according to the first and fourth editions of the Iran Earthquake Standard 2800. The RCMFs designed according to the first edition are strengthened and reinforced using the SB system. The studied structures were analyzed under incremental static loading and time history analysis. The results show that the yield force and maximum base shear for the structures designed with the fourth edition, compared to the structures designed with the first edition, have increased by 1.28–1.42. This demonstrates the necessity of improving structures constructed according to the first edition. Meanwhile, the results of the retrofitted structures with strongback braces show the same or better performance than newly designed structures. The results of the fragility analysis show that the addition of the strong bracing system significantly improves the performance of the structures and brings them closer to the 4th edition standards. The retrofitting system reduces drift ratio between floors and reduces structural damage

    Assessment of cyclic behavior and performance of hybrid linked-column steel plate shear wall system

    No full text
    An innovative hybrid linked columns steel plate shear wall (HLCS) system provided, and its cyclic behavior and energy absorption are investigated by finite element method in this study. The objective of the designed HLCS system was to reduce or possibly prevent damage to the SPSW at low and medium seismic levels by focusing the seismic damage to interchangeable link beams (the energy dissipation components of the presented HLCS system). In this study, the cyclic behavior and energy dissipation of HLCS systems were investigated using numerical methods. To evaluate the hysteresis behavior and energy absorption of the proposed HLCS system, parametric studies were performed. Also, the accuracy of finite element models was evaluated by comparing test results that showed the good accuracy of finite element models in predicting the specimens' hysteresis behavior and failure modes. Due to the failure mechanisms, the coupling ratio amounts meaningfully affect the onset of the first surrender mechanism between the infill steel plate and link beams. In general, by increasing the number of link beams in the floor, the ultimate shear force to the weight ratio of the structure was increased. Also, the type of beam in terms of flexural and shear behavior did not significantly affect the ratio of base shear force to the structure weight. The proposed HLCS system has increased the ratio of base shear force to the weight by an average of 4%–27%, indicating that this system is economically comparable to the SPSW systems. Moreover, the energy dissipation in the HLCS system exhibited a 14%–91% enhancement compared to the SPSW system

    Functioning of Notaries in the Field of Public Ethics

Considering the extent and influence of notaries on the legal relations of individuals in the society, the present study examines the position of notaries in the field of public ethics. Materials and Methods: The method used in this study is descriptive-analytical; In other words, by examining the formation, historical and legal developments of the registration of deeds and property, the role of notaries in the public moral field is explained. Ethical Considerations: In all stages of this research, while observing the authenticity of the texts, honesty and fidelity have been observed. Findings: Social institutions such as notaries have an influential function in the fields of common good, public services and dejudicialization from the community, defense of the rule of law and transparency, as well as providing services based on formal and non-discriminatory relations, which is why they are closely linked to public morality. In other words, if the above-mentioned functions are performed, notaries can organize the relevant field of public ethics of the society. Conclusion: Due to the importance of written and official documents, notaries play a prominent role in reducing disputes, lawsuits and judicial problems, and thus provide security in the field of public ethics. Accordingly, notaries should have more access to the judiciary and legal field and, while dejudicialization from the community, along with the institutions of judiciary, offer their services to the community. This can be a great help in resolving problems before going to the judiciary when it is based on the submission and acceptance of official documents to resolve disputes.   Please cite this article as: Abdul Maleki M, Hashemi SM, Gorji Azandariani AA.     Cyclic behavior of an energy dissipation system with the vertical steel panel flexural-yielding dampers

    In this study, an energy dissipation system of the vertical steel panel flexural-yielding dampers (VSPFYDs) system is provided and investigated using a numerical method. The aim of this study is to provide an energy absorption system to improve the hysteresis behavior and performance of steel slit dampers (SSDs). Hence, two types of VSPFYDs and SSDs systems with connection details are provided and developed numerical models for parametric study. Extensive parametric studies have been performed to evaluate and compare the proposed damper (VSPFYDs) with traditional SSDs. To evaluate the proposed dampers, the nonlinear finite element models were developed to predict the hysteretic behavior of VSPFYDs and SSDs using ABAQUS software and ultimately validated with the results of several test specimens. To evaluate the results of this study, a comparison is performed between the seismic parameters of SSDs and VSPFYDs. The results show that the vertical steel panel flexural-yielding dampers increase the seismic parameters compared to the steel slit dampers. Also, the results showed both VSPFYDs and SSDs showed flexural behavior. Finally, the stiffness degradation of dampers was investigated and found that the smallest VSPFYD with a height of 15 cm has the best performance in many aspects. Also, the results show that the details of the construction of the plate connections considerably affected the performance and hysteresis behavior of the VSPFYDs compared to SSDs

    Numerical and analytical study of ultimate capacity of steel plate shear walls with partial plate-column connection (SPSW-PC)

    This research endeavor intends to use the numerical and analytical approaches to investigate the ultimate shear capacity of steel plate shear walls with partial plate-column connection (SPSW-PC). This study aims to provide an analytical relationship for estimating the ultimate capacity of SPSW-PC. Using plastic analysis and considering the mechanism of plastic hinge formation, a relation has been obtained for estimating the ultimate capacity of SPSW-PCs. Extensive parametric studies have been carried out using a nonlinear finite element method to examine the accuracy of the obtained analytical relationships. The parametric studies include investigating the influence of infill plate thickness and width-to-height ratio as well as the ratio of the plate-column detachment length of SPSW-PCs. To this end, comprehensive verification studies are initially performed by comparing the numerical predictions with several reported experimental results to demonstrate the numerical method's reliability and accuracy. Comparison is made between the hysteresis curves, failure modes, and base shear capacities predicted numerically or obtained/observed experimentally. The results show a sound compromise between the ultimate capacity of the analytical relationship and numerical models of parametric studies. Although removing the connection between the web-plate and columns can be beneficial by decreasing the overall system demand on the vertical boundary members, based on the results and findings of this research study, such detachment can reduce the stiffness and strength capacities of steel shear walls by about 25%, on average
